Transaction c52f0e06bf31c16844ee10bac9950ab3fc647ec2004823d32e39dfd28906664c
1 Input
1 Output
-
c52f0e06bf31c16844ee10bac9950ab3fc647ec2004823d32e39dfd28906664c:0
- value
- 6604258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c48da2f17b08089ac0680e64c8b2c650e34cfed4 OP_EQUAL
- address
- 3KcJ3DeXHfugWU1rvxrEBFfbm1EDJo3vVC